The metaverse, which comes under the video games industry, is a fast-growing digital frontier where immersive tech creates interactive virtual worlds. It is built on virtual reality (VR), augmented reality (AR), blockchain, and mixed reality, offering simulated spaces for socializing, working, learning, and playing. Essentially, it blends digital and physical realities to provide customized and immersive experiences via avatars, live communication, and spatial computing. Users no longer just browse static web pages – they move through dynamic 3D environments that mirror and enhance real-world interactions, marking a shift from simple apps to fully immersive virtual spaces. Metaverse is segmented into four types: lifelogging, augmented reality, mirror world, and virtual reality.
The metaverse grows mainly by combining content streaming and blockchain infrastructure, where blockchain has improved secure transactions, digital asset ownership, and governance. These systems support user-driven economies where people build, sell, and profit from digital experiences, similar to Roblox. At the same time, the rise of 3D platforms, virtual markets, and gaming worlds drives investment.
In 2024, the global video streaming market—crucial for immersive media—hit $674.25 billion. The Business Research Company reports that the global metaverse market is predicted to grow from $227.05 billion in 2024 to $316.34 billion in 2025, with a strong 39.3% CAGR. Whereas, S&P Global Market Intelligence predicts that global metaverse revenue will climb from $17.5 billion in 2023 to $54.5 billion by 2028, growing at a 25.5% CAGR. Businesses became the main customer segment, driven by the need for digital twin software and remote collaboration tools. According to S&P, these businesses strengthened their position in 2023, accounting for 42.8% of the entire metaverse market. As major companies expand virtual platforms and adopt faster streaming, metaverse services strengthen across industries.
Moreover, social media and mobile internet have sped up the growth of the virtual ecosystem. With over 2.4 billion users on Meta (previously Facebook) and billions more on WhatsApp and YouTube, the digital world is more connected than ever. The line between digital and physical life keeps blurring as many daily activities—hanging out, entertainment, shopping—are already happening in early metaverse settings. This has sparked the development of virtual learning, workplace collaborative tools, and blockchain-based gaming economies. According to NewGenApps, VR and AR gaming is set to reach 216 million players worldwide by 2025, with a market worth $11.6 billion. Markedly, a 2024 survey revealed that 34% of game developers globally are creating titles for the Meta Quest Store, a digital marketplace, showing strong developer interest in immersive gaming platforms.
Furthermore, generative AI is reshaping the next phase of the metaverse, ranging from custom content suggestions to auto-dubbing, editing, and better visuals. Streaming platforms now use large language models like GPT-4 to create real-time content and ensure moderation, making digital interactions safer and more accessible. Although the broader metaverse is still under development, technologies powering virtual economies—such as play-to-earn games, NFT marketplaces, and digital event tickets—already create income opportunities for users and developers. The Entertainment Software Association reported that 227 million Americans play video games every week, with an average age of 31. This shows a growing mainstream adoption of immersive content across different age groups. The combination of AI with VR/AR is helping platforms expand beyond gaming and entertainment into healthcare and business applications.
As users want more personalized, high-resolution experiences, metaverse tech is advancing on low-latency infrastructures. Platforms like hesp.live are changing streaming with super-fast delivery for gaming, education, and live shopping. Initially, the metaverse faced a lot of backlash due to a not-so-appealing experience and inability to connect with users. Despite less public buzz after 2022, progress hasn't stopped—the metaverse is young, with ongoing improvements pushing it forward. These advances, plus the growing demand for video-on-demand services, show how deeply the metaverse fits into digital viewing habits. As North America leads the market, with major players and high digital spending, Asia Pacific is also set for future growth due to the quick adoption of immersive tech.
This shows that the metaverse isn't just a passing trend—it is a fundamental shift changing how people live, talk, and connect in digital spaces. As immersive environments disrupt traditional media, the metaverse is becoming a promising investment.

Roblox Corporation (NYSE:RBLX) runs a 3D platform where users can connect, communicate, and create. The company offers the Roblox Client for exploring virtual worlds, Studio for making content, and Cloud for real-time support. Thus, Roblox stands out in the metaverse through user-created experiences, social features, and partnerships with brands and creators, cementing its role in advancing immersive 3D content. As a result, it is ranked among the best metaverse stocks.
For Q4 ending December 31, 2024, Roblox Corporation (NYSE:RBLX) posted $988 million in revenue, growing 32% year-over-year and exceeding the company's guidance. Bookings hit $1.36 billion, an increase of 21% from the previous year. Daily users jumped 19% to 85.3 million, with over 61% being 13 or older; furthermore, people spent 18.7 billion hours on the platform, which is a 21% increase. Free cash flow shot up 54% to $120 million in Q4, while yearly free cash flow reached $641 million (five times higher than in 2023).
Roblox Corporation (NYSE:RBLX) keeps growing as it shared $922 million with creators in 2024 through DevEx, up 25% from last year. The company made improvements with real-time pricing, a customizable avatar marketplace, and enhanced monetization through platform-specific Robux incentives. The company's success also came from expanding content variety with major IP-based activations and breakout experiences like 'NFL Universe' and 'SpongeBob' gaining traction.
Looking forward, Roblox aims to host 10% of global gaming content, up from today's 2.4%. The company plans to improve live 3D streaming, cross-device access, and AI creation tools. For Q1 2025, Roblox is expected to bring AI text generation, with 3D AI features following in Q2. Despite economic uncertainties, Roblox Corporation (NYSE:RBLX) is focused on operational efficiency, reliable infrastructure, and growing users through innovation and partnerships.

Why Zumiez (ZUMZ) Stock Is Falling Today
Shares of clothing and footwear retailer Zumiez (NASDAQ:ZUMZ) fell 7.9% in the afternoon session after the company reported mixed first quarter 2025 results: its EBITDA missed and its EPS guidance for next quarter fell short of Wall Street's estimates. On the other hand, Zumiez narrowly topped analysts' revenue expectations and its revenue guidance for next quarter slightly exceeded Wall Street's estimates. Still, this was a softer quarter. The shares closed the day at $11.54, down 10.3% from previous close. The stock market overreacts to news, and big price drops can present good opportunities to buy high-quality stocks. Is now the time to buy Zumiez? Access our full analysis report here, it's free. Zumiez's shares are extremely volatile and have had 32 moves greater than 5% over the last year. In that context, today's move indicates the market considers this news meaningful but not something that would fundamentally change its perception of the business. The previous big move we wrote about was 10 days ago when the stock gained 5.8% on the news that the major indices rebounded (Nasdaq +2.0%, S&P 500 +2.0%) as President Trump postponed the planned 50% tariff on European Union imports, shifting the start date to July 9, 2025. Companies with substantial business ties to Europe likely had some relief as the delay reduced near-term cost pressures and preserved cross-border demand. Zumiez is down 39% since the beginning of the year, and at $11.58 per share, it is trading 60.2% below its 52-week high of $29.11 from August 2024. Investors who bought $1,000 worth of Zumiez's shares 5 years ago would now be looking at an investment worth $383.70. Hyatt Announces Receipt of All Required Regulatory Approvals for Pending Acquisition of Playa Hotels & Resorts N.V.
CHICAGO, June 06, 2025--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Hyatt Hotels Corporation ("Hyatt" or the "Company") (NYSE: H), a leading global hospitality company, announced today that all required regulatory approvals have been obtained for its previously announced cash tender offer to purchase all of the outstanding ordinary shares of Playa Hotels & Resorts N.V. ("Playa") (NASDAQ: PLYA) for $13.50 per share in cash, less any applicable withholding taxes and without interest. The offer is being made pursuant to the previously announced purchase agreement, dated February 9, 2025 (the "Purchase Agreement"), among Hyatt, HI Holdings Playa B.V. ("Buyer") and Playa. On June 5, 2025, pursuant to the provisions of the Federal Law of Economic Competition (Ley Federal de Competencia Económica), the Federal Competition Commission (Comisión Federal de Competencia Económica) issued a resolution approving the transactions contemplated by the Purchase Agreement. As a result of the regulatory approvals, Hyatt expects to complete the tender offer promptly following the expiration of the offer, which is scheduled to expire at 5:00 p.m., New York City time, on June 9, 2025. Completion of the tender offer remains subject to the conditions described in the tender offer statement on Schedule TO. Assuming the minimum tender and other offer conditions are satisfied, the tendered shares are expected to be accepted for payment on or about June 11, 2025. Pursuant to the terms of the Purchase Agreement, if the minimum tender condition in the tender offer is satisfied, along with certain other closing conditions expected to be satisfied at expiration, then on June 10, 2025, Hyatt will commence a subsequent offering period for the tender offer for any Playa ordinary shares not already tendered, which will expire at 11:59 p.m., New York City time, on June 16, 2025. Following this subsequent offering period and the related transactions required by the Purchase Agreement, Hyatt expects to own all ordinary shares of Playa on or about June 17, 2025.
